The Vedas are ancient scripts from an unknown religion in India, first recorded in about 1500 BCE. The four sacred text collections that compromise the Vedas are: Rig Veda, Yajur Veda, Sama Veda, and Atharva Veda. The first, Rig Veda means hymn knowledge and describes how the universe was created from a being that existed before existence, and created the universe by his sacrificing himself. About The Child's Pose is a popular beginner's yoga pose. It is frequently utilized as a resting position in among more difficult poses throughout a yoga practice. How To Come to all fours (Table Pose) exhale and lower your hips to your heels and forehead to the floor. Place your knees together or spread your knees somewhat apart, if more comfortable. 2. PŌWHIRI – THE MĀORI WELCOME The pōwhiri, a central part of Māori protocol, is a welcoming ceremony that takes place on the marae. The intention of a pōwhiri is to formally unite the manuhiri (visitors) with the tangata whenua (hosts) through a series of rituals of encounter.…
The Māori worldview is holistic and cyclic, and refers to the core ideas and beliefs which govern the way in which Māori perceive and interact with the world around them (Newman, 2016). A key aspect of this view is determined by the many different cultural concepts. Māori cultural concepts all originate from the creation narratives, stories of atua (gods), and are not isolated, but are related to one another (Carter, 2016).
